I have a 3 week old Lenovo X61. I leave my computer on hibernate whenever I turn it off. For some reason, and it seems to happen every Tuesday of the week, the battery will drain itself.
I unplugged it for about 6 hours during today and when I turned it back on the battery went from 100% to 91%. If I leave it on hibernate for the entire night, it would wake up the next morning with 82% left.
The strange thing is it seems to only happen on Tuesdays. I can have it on hibernate and unplugged and it seems to lose less than 1% on other days (still need to confirm this fully).
I did a factory reinstall and left only the battery management software along with just basic Windows Vista but the problem still seems to be occurring.
What software could be interfering with hibernation I wonder??

I'm not sure if this would effect a hibernating machine, but Windows updates occur once a month on Tuesday. Anti-virus updates and scans also come to mind.

Thanks. Since my Thinkpad is pretty much a closed system, I don't have any antivirus software on it at the moment. I updated to the latest software versions via Lenovo's System update program and then uninstalled it and also uninstalled the Rescue and Recovery software. I turned off automatic Windows updates and even turned off the synchronize time feature. Whatever was waking up the machine seemed to have been turned off.
After a few more weeks of testing, my battery has drained about 1% on its on in the last two weeks. I only use my X61 sparingly on the go and for the past weeks I have noticed a constant 99-100% battery life when waking up from hibernation after a couple days of non-use.
I specifically have only been using it only connected to the wall outlet for the past couple of weeks and checking the battery meter every time I boot up, the battery has not needed to receive any recharge at all since it is over 96%. It is disconnected from the wall everytime after hibernation to make sure it is not recharging when off. I just installed Vista SP1 and will see if anything has changed.
